The history of ancient Egypt is a long and fascinating one, stretching back over five thousand years. Throughout this time, Egypt was a land of great cultural and political significance, and it played a central role in the development of the ancient world. In this essay, we will provide an outline of Egyptian history, highlighting some of the key events and developments that shaped the course of this ancient civilization.

The earliest known civilization in Egypt is thought to have emerged around 4000 BCE, in the Nile Valley. The Nile was an essential resource for the ancient Egyptians, providing them with water, fertile soil, and a means of transportation. The ancient Egyptians developed a complex system of irrigation and built dams and levees to control the flow of the river, which allowed them to cultivate crops such as wheat and barley, as well as raise livestock.

During the early period of Egyptian history, the country was divided into a number of smaller kingdoms, each with its own ruler. However, around 3100 BCE, the Pharaoh Menes united these kingdoms under a single rule, establishing the first dynasty of Egypt. The Pharaohs were absolute rulers, and they oversaw a highly centralized government that oversaw all aspects of life in ancient Egypt.

Throughout its history, Egypt was a land of great religious significance. The ancient Egyptians believed in a pantheon of gods and goddesses, and they built elaborate temples and tombs to honor them. The Pharaohs were also seen as divine rulers, and they were believed to be the intermediaries between the gods and the people.

Egypt's prosperity was largely due to its location along the Nile, which provided a rich and fertile environment for agriculture. The ancient Egyptians were skilled farmers and developed sophisticated systems of irrigation and land management. They also engaged in trade with other civilizations in the region, such as the Assyrians and the Persians.

However, despite its prosperity, Egypt was also a land of great conflict. Throughout its history, it was invaded and conquered by a number of different powers, including the Persians, the Greeks, and the Romans. These invasions had a significant impact on the course of Egyptian history, and they contributed to the decline of the ancient civilization.

The final period of ancient Egyptian history was known as the Late Period, which lasted from 664 BCE to 332 BCE. During this time, Egypt was ruled by a series of foreign powers, including the Persians and the Greeks. The final Pharaoh, Cleopatra, was a member of the Ptolemaic dynasty, which was of Greek origin. She is perhaps the most well-known Pharaoh in history, due in large part to her relationship with Julius Caesar and Mark Antony.

In conclusion, the history of ancient Egypt is a long and complex one, full of great achievements and challenges. From its earliest days as a collection of small kingdoms to its final years as a conquered land, Egypt played a central role in the development of the ancient world and its legacy can still be seen today.
